Table des matières
- Méthode 1 : Ajouter un filigrane à l'aide de l'en-tête et du pied de page
- Méthode 2 : Insérer une image d'arrière-plan comme filigrane
- Méthode 3 : Insérer un WordArt ou des formes comme filigrane
- Méthode 4 : Ajouter des filigranes à Excel par programmation à l'aide de Python
- Comparaison des méthodes de filigrane
- Réflexions finales
- FAQ sur l'ajout de filigranes à Excel

Les filigranes sont largement utilisés dans les fichiers Excel pour indiquer l'état ou la propriété d'un document, tel que Confidentiel, Brouillon, Exemple, ou un logo d'entreprise. Ils sont particulièrement utiles lors du partage de rapports en interne ou de la distribution de fichiers à des parties prenantes externes.
Contrairement à Microsoft Word, Excel ne propose pas de fonctionnalité « Filigrane » dédiée. Cependant, il existe plusieurs moyens pratiques d'obtenir le même effet en utilisant des outils intégrés ou des solutions programmatiques.
Dans cet article, vous apprendrez quatre façons simples et efficaces d'ajouter des filigranes à Excel, allant des techniques manuelles au filigrane automatisé à l'aide de Python.
Aperçu des méthodes :
- Méthode 1 : Ajouter un filigrane à l'aide de l'en-tête et du pied de page
- Méthode 2 : Insérer une image d'arrière-plan comme filigrane
- Méthode 3 : Insérer un WordArt ou des formes comme filigrane
- Méthode 4 : Ajouter des filigranes à Excel par programmation à l'aide de Python
Méthode 1 : Ajouter un filigrane à l'aide de l'en-tête et du pied de page
L'utilisation de la fonctionnalité En-tête et pied de page est la manière la plus largement acceptée d'ajouter un filigrane dans Excel, en particulier pour les documents qui seront imprimés ou exportés au format PDF.
Parce que le filigrane est placé en dehors de la grille de la feuille de calcul, il n'interfère pas avec le contenu des cellules tout en restant cohérent sur toutes les pages.
Cette méthode fonctionne bien pour ajouter des images de logos ou de « brouillon » à des rapports formels et des documents officiels.
Étapes
-
Ouvrez votre fichier Excel.
-
Allez dans Insertion → En-tête et pied de page.

-
Cliquez sur la section centrale de l'en-tête.

-
Cliquez sur Image dans la section En-tête et pied de page pour insérer un filigrane d'image, ou saisissez directement du texte.

Remarque : Un filigrane d'image est recommandé, car le texte d'en-tête rend souvent difficile l'obtention d'une apparence de filigrane efficace.
-
Appuyez n'importe où en dehors de l'en-tête pour voir le filigrane.

Avantages
- Imprimable.
- Apparence propre et professionnelle.
- Convient aux logos et aux étiquettes de documents.
Inconvénients
- Non visible en mode Normal.
- Flexibilité de formatage limitée.
Meilleur cas d'utilisation
Cette méthode est la mieux adaptée aux documents Excel formels ou partageables où le filigrane doit apparaître à l'impression, dans l'aperçu avant impression ou dans les PDF exportés sans interférer avec les données de la feuille de calcul.
Méthode 2 : Insérer une image d'arrière-plan comme filigrane
Excel vous permet d'insérer une image comme arrière-plan de feuille de calcul, qui peut servir de filigrane. Ce filigrane reste visible en mode Normal, ce qui le rend utile pour la révision à l'écran, le partage interne ou les fichiers de modèle.
Cependant, les images d'arrière-plan sont conçues uniquement à des fins de référence visuelle et n'apparaîtront pas lors de l'impression ou de l'exportation au format PDF.
Étapes
-
Ouvrez votre fichier Excel.
-
Allez dans Mise en page → Arrière-plan.

-
Sélectionnez un fichier image.

-
L'image se répétera sur toute la feuille de calcul.

Avantages
- Visible en mode Normal.
- Simple à appliquer.
- S'applique à toute la feuille de calcul.
Inconvénients
- Non imprimable.
- Personnalisation limitée.
Meilleur cas d'utilisation
Cette méthode est la mieux adaptée aux documents internes ou aux modèles de travail où la visibilité lors de l'édition est plus importante que le résultat imprimé.
Méthode 3 : Insérer un WordArt ou des formes comme filigrane
L'insertion d'un WordArt, d'une Zone de texte ou d'une Forme offre le plus de contrôle sur l'apparence d'un filigrane.
Parce que le filigrane est un objet de feuille de calcul ordinaire, il reste visible en mode Normal et peut être librement redimensionné, pivoté et stylisé.
Cette approche est idéale lorsque vous avez besoin de filigranes textuels personnalisés ou de styles de filigrane différents sur des feuilles individuelles.
Étapes
-
Allez dans Insertion → WordArt.

-
Sélectionnez un style prédéfini dans le menu déroulant.

-
Saisissez le texte du filigrane (par exemple, « CONFIDENTIEL »).

-
Faites pivoter la forme et ajustez l'apparence (taille, couleur ou style) du texte selon vos besoins.

Avantages
- Entièrement personnalisable.
- Visible en mode Normal.
- Facile à modifier ou à supprimer.
Inconvénients
- Peut se déplacer lors du redimensionnement des lignes ou des colonnes.
- Nécessite une configuration manuelle par feuille de calcul.
Meilleur cas d'utilisation
Cette méthode est la mieux adaptée aux scénarios de révision à l'écran où le filigrane doit rester visible en mode Normal et où un style de texte flexible ou un étiquetage spécifique à la feuille est requis.
Méthode 4 : Ajouter des filigranes à Excel par programmation à l'aide de Python
Lorsque le filigrane doit être appliqué de manière répétée ou sur plusieurs fichiers, l'automatisation programmatique est l'approche la plus efficace.
En utilisant Spire.XLS for Python, vous pouvez ajouter des filigranes par programmation de la même manière que les méthodes manuelles décrites précédemment, y compris les filigranes d'en-tête/pied de page, les filigranes d'image d'arrière-plan et les filigranes basés sur des formes.
Cela garantit des résultats cohérents tout en réduisant l'effort manuel, en particulier dans les flux de travail de génération de rapports ou de distribution de documents.
Exemple : Ajouter un filigrane d'image via l'en-tête et le pied de page
L'exemple suivant ajoute un filigrane d'image à l'en-tête central de chaque feuille de calcul. Cette méthode est équivalente à la Méthode 1 et produit un filigrane qui apparaît en mode Mise en page, dans l'Aperçu avant impression et dans les PDF exportés.
from spire.xls import *
from spire.xls.common import *
# Create a Workbook object
workbook = Workbook()
# Load an Excel document
workbook.LoadFromFile("C:\\Users\\Administrator\\Desktop\\Input.xlsx")
# Load the watermark image
stream = Stream("C:\\Users\\Administrator\\Desktop\\confidential.png")
# Apply the watermark to all worksheets
for i in range(workbook.Worksheets.Count):
worksheet = workbook.Worksheets[i]
worksheet.PageSetup.CenterHeader = "&G"
worksheet.PageSetup.CenterHeaderImage = stream
# Save the result
workbook.SaveToFile("output/AddWatermark.xlsx", ExcelVersion.Version2016)
# Release resources
workbook.Dispose()
Cas d'utilisation typiques
- Vous devez ajouter un filigrane à plusieurs fichiers ou feuilles de calcul Excel.
- Les filigranes doivent être appliqués de manière cohérente et automatique.
- Les fichiers Excel sont générés dans le cadre d'un pipeline de reporting ou d'exportation.
Pour explorer les fonctionnalités d'automatisation Excel supplémentaires et les détails d'utilisation de l'API, consultez le Guide de programmation Spire.XLS. Le guide couvre des exemples pratiques qui peuvent vous aider à étendre la logique de filigrane et à créer des solutions de traitement Excel plus flexibles.
Comparaison des méthodes de filigrane
| Méthode | Imprimable | Visible en mode Normal | Personnalisable | Automatisation |
|---|---|---|---|---|
| En-tête et pied de page | ✔ | ✖ | Limité | ✔ |
| Image d'arrière-plan | ✖ | ✔ | ✖ | ✔ |
| WordArt / Forme | ✔ | ✔ | ✔ | Limité |
| Automatisation Python | ✔ / ✖ | ✔ / ✖ | Contrôlé | ✔✔ |
Réflexions finales
Bien qu'Excel ne propose pas de fonctionnalité de filigrane intégrée, il offre plusieurs moyens fiables d'obtenir le même résultat. La meilleure approche dépend de la manière dont le fichier sera utilisé et distribué.
- Utilisez les filigranes En-tête et pied de page pour les documents professionnels qui seront imprimés ou exportés au format PDF.
- Utilisez les images d'arrière-plan ou le WordArt lorsque la visibilité du filigrane lors de l'édition à l'écran est la priorité.
- Utilisez l'automatisation Python avec Spire.XLS lorsque les filigranes doivent être appliqués de manière cohérente sur plusieurs fichiers ou dans le cadre d'un flux de travail automatisé.
En choisissant la méthode qui correspond à vos exigences de visibilité et de sortie, vous pouvez ajouter des filigranes clairs et efficaces à Excel sans perturber la lisibilité des données ou la structure du document.
FAQ sur l'ajout de filigranes à Excel
Q1. Excel a-t-il une fonctionnalité de filigrane intégrée ?
Non. Excel ne propose pas de bouton de filigrane dédié, mais plusieurs alternatives efficaces sont disponibles.
Q2. Pourquoi mon filigrane n'apparaît-il pas en mode Normal ?
Les filigranes d'en-tête et de pied de page ne sont visibles qu'en mode Mise en page ou dans l'Aperçu avant impression.
Q3. Puis-je ajouter des filigranes différents à différentes feuilles ?
Oui. Cela peut être fait manuellement ou par programmation en appliquant des paramètres par feuille de calcul.
Q4. Quelle est la meilleure façon d'ajouter un filigrane à des fichiers Excel en masse ?
L'utilisation de l'automatisation Python avec Spire.XLS est l'approche la plus efficace et la plus évolutive.